The NHTSA requested a response by June 19. The letter said Tesla may be fined up to $27,874 per day if the agency does not receive a prompt response, with a maximum fine of $139,356,994.
The NHTSA letter aims to determine whether the automated driving software Tesla will use for its planned robotaxi service is the same or similar to FSD Supervised available to Tesla customers.

NHTSA said in a statement emailed to the Detroit Free Press that under President Joe Biden, the agency grew 30% and remains larger than it had in previous administrations despite the cuts.
NHTSA employed nearly 800 people as of January. It is relatively small but plays a leading role in the federal government’s efforts to reduce the annual death toll on the nation’s roads.
